Autodesk Build daily logs vs SuperReports at a glance
Both produce a record of the day. The difference is what you buy to get it: Autodesk's daily log comes with the platform around it, SuperReports is the report by itself.
| SuperReports | Autodesk Build daily logs | |
|---|---|---|
| Best for | Supers who owe a daily report — solo or org-wide | Teams already running the full Autodesk Construction Cloud stack |
| Core focus | Fast daily reports + 3-week look-ahead planning | Broad construction platform; the daily log is one module inside it |
| Report workflow | Take photos + talk; AI writes the report | Daily logs entered in the platform alongside the rest of the project record |
| Voice-to-report AI | Yes — speak your day, AI structures the full report | Logs are entered rather than spoken |
| 3-week look-ahead | Yes | Not part of the daily log |
| Pricing transparency | Published openly on the pricing page | Quote-based — no per-user rates published |
| Free plan | Yes — Starter files a full report, no card | Trial and subscription; no free tier for the daily log |
| Safety in the report | Yes — observations, incidents, toolbox talks and inspections are a section of every report | Handled in the platform's own quality and safety tooling |
| Org-wide report roll-up | Yes — team dashboard on every plan | Yes — within the platform |
| Pricing | Free Starter; $29 / super / mo; Team flat $279 / mo at 10+ supers (UK: £25 / super / mo, Team £229 / mo; eurozone: €25 / super / mo, Team €249 / mo) | Quote-based; contact sales |
Autodesk publishes no per-user rates for Autodesk Build; its pricing page directs buyers to sales. Checked September 2026.
Why supers look for an Autodesk Build daily log alternative
Rarely because the log is bad. Usually because of what surrounds it:
1. You can't find out what it costs. Autodesk Build is quote-based — there are no per-user rates published, so working out whether the daily log is worth it means a sales conversation first. SuperReports lists every price on its pricing page: free to start, $29 per super per month, flat $279/mo Team at 10 or more supers.
2. The log arrives attached to a platform. Model coordination, RFIs, submittals, cost and closeout are the reason most firms buy Autodesk Build. If the daily report is genuinely the job to be done, that's a large surface to carry for one module.
3. Entering a log is still typing. SuperReports is photos plus voice — you talk through the day and the report writes itself in about two minutes, with no training and no forms at the end of a long shift.
When Autodesk Build is the better choice
If your project already runs on Autodesk Construction Cloud, the daily log belongs where the rest of the record lives. Logs sitting next to the drawings, RFIs and submittals they refer to is a real advantage, and SuperReports doesn't try to replace any of that.

Frequently asked questions
How much do Autodesk Build daily logs cost?
Autodesk doesn't publish per-user pricing for Autodesk Build — the pricing page routes to sales for a quote, so the daily log's cost depends on the bundle you're quoted. SuperReports publishes its pricing: a free Starter plan, $29 per super per month, and a flat $279/mo Team plan at 10 or more supers. UK customers are billed in pounds (£25 per super per month, £229/mo for Team) and eurozone customers in euros (€25 per super per month, €249/mo for Team), excluding VAT.
Is there a cheaper alternative to Autodesk Build for daily reports?
For the daily report specifically, yes — SuperReports starts free and is $29 per super per month. Whether it's cheaper than your Autodesk quote depends on that quote, but you can see the SuperReports number without asking anyone.
Does SuperReports do everything Autodesk Build does?
No, and deliberately. Autodesk Build is a broad construction platform — model coordination, RFIs, submittals, cost, closeout. SuperReports does the daily report and 3-week look-ahead planning. If you need the platform, Autodesk is the better fit.
